   Evaluation of Serum Copper Level in Pregnant Women with High Hemoglobin

چکیده    Adverse outcomes of pregnancy increase among women withhigh density of hemoglobin. this study eval uates the effects ofiron supplementation on serum copper level in pregnantwomen with hemoglobin higher than 13.2 g/dl. sixty twopregnant women with hemoglobin >13.2 g/dl and normal serumcopper levels in their 13-18 weeks of gestation were randomizedinto case and control groups. from 20'h week till theend of the pregnancy ferrous sui fate tablets (150 mg tablet,containing 50 mg elemental iron) were given to the case groupwhereas, the controls received daily placebo tablets. hemoglobinand serum copper levels were measured during theweeks of24 to 28 (first trimester) and 32 to 36 (second trimester).serum copper level of the case group during the secondand third trimester was significantly lower than of the controlgroup. lt is concluded that, iron supplementation in pregnantwomen with hemoglobin above 13.2 g/dl possibil ity increases therisk of copper deficiency.
